解决Telegram for Mac登录问题的全面指南
Telegram作为一款广受欢迎的即时通讯应用,以其安全性和跨平台同步功能著称。然而,部分Mac用户在尝试登录桌面客户端时,可能会遇到无法登录的困扰。这个问题可能由多种因素导致,从简单的网络设置到复杂的软件冲突。本文将系统性地分析可能的原因,并提供一系列行之有效的解决方案,帮助您恢复Telegram的正常使用。
常见原因分析
首先,理解问题的根源是解决的第一步。Mac版Telegram登录失败通常可以归因于以下几个方面:网络连接问题是最常见的原因,包括不稳定的Wi-Fi、防火墙或代理设置阻止了Telegram连接其服务器;应用程序本身的问题,如版本过旧、缓存文件损坏或安装不完整;系统权限限制,macOS的安全设置可能阻止Telegram访问必要的资源;最后,也可能是Telegram服务器暂时故障,虽然这种情况较为罕见。

分步排查与解决方案
接下来,我们可以按照从简到繁的顺序进行排查。首先,请检查您的互联网连接。尝试访问其他网站或服务,确保网络通畅。如果使用VPN或代理,请暂时禁用它们,因为Telegram在某些地区或特定网络环境下可能会受到限制。同时,可以访问如“Downdetector”等网站,查看Telegram服务器是否出现全球性的服务中断。
如果网络无误,第二步是重启应用程序并更新。完全退出Telegram(通过菜单栏退出或使用Command+Q),然后重新启动。接着,访问Telegram官方网站或Mac App Store,确保您安装的是最新版本。开发者经常通过更新来修复已知的登录漏洞和兼容性问题。
高级故障排除步骤
当基础步骤无效时,需要进行更深层的操作。清理应用程序缓存和数据是一个有效方法。请完全退出Telegram,然后打开Finder,按下Command+Shift+G,输入路径 ~/Library/Group Containers/ 和 ~/Library/Application Support/,查找并删除名为“ru.keepcoder.Telegram”或“com.telegram.desktop”的文件夹(请注意,此操作会清除本地缓存消息,但云端消息不受影响)。删除后,重新启动Telegram。
此外,检查macOS系统权限也至关重要。前往“系统设置” > “隐私与安全性” > “辅助功能”或“屏幕录制”等类别,检查Telegram是否有相应的权限。有时,重新勾选或移除后重新添加权限可以解决问题。如果问题依然存在,可以尝试创建一个新的Mac用户账户进行登录测试,以判断是否是原用户账户的系统配置文件损坏。
最后的应对策略
如果以上所有方法均告失败,考虑进行完全卸载后重新安装。使用专业的卸载工具或手动删除所有相关文件(包括上述缓存路径中的文件),然后从官方渠道下载最新的安装包进行全新安装。作为替代方案,您也可以暂时使用Telegram的Web版本(web.telegram.org) 或 官方TDesktop版本,它们有时比App Store版本更新更及时。
总而言之,Telegram for Mac登录问题虽然令人烦恼,但通常可以通过系统性的排查来解决。从检查网络到清理深层缓存,大多数情况都属于软件环境配置问题。保持应用程序为最新版本,并关注Telegram官方公告,是预防此类问题的最佳实践。如果所有自助方法都无效,联系Telegram官方支持并提供详细的错误信息,将是最终的选择。

